Dr. Moni Ahmadian (Dental) co-authored and presented "Central Xanthoma of Mandible in a 12 Year-Old Boy" to the American Academy of Oral and Maxillofacial Pathology during a virtual meeting in April.

Tim Gauthier (Interdisciplinary, Gender, and Ethnic Studies) recently published a peer-reviewed article in the Journal of Veterans Studies: "'I Can Spin Some Bullshit if You Want': Narrating (and Bridging?) the Civil-Military Divide in Phil Klay's Redeployment."

Dr. Patrick Wallace (Medicine) recently had several peer-reviewed papers published in medical journals. They include:  "Top 10 Evidence-Based Countermeasures for Night Shift Workers"  "Identifying and Managing Coronavirus in the ED" "Debunking Dysbarism" (diving-related disorders)
